WebNov 7, 2024 · More specifically, stiffness has to do with resistance to deformation. The property that measures stiffness is the modulus of elasticity aka Young's modulus, and its also measure in MPa (like strength). WebJun 30, 2024 · Toughness measures a material’s ability to resist high-impact forces without breaking, fracturing, or deforming. A tough material is strong and can bear loads of force, but it’s also ductile and able to stretch under pressure.
